Scheduling an interview for your Global Entry application is hard. Some enrollment centers are months out. But they tend to sneakily add slots in the near future. This script will alert you when that happens.
This script uses the new (2017-10) but undocumented API at https://ttp.cbp.dhs.gov/schedulerapi/slots/asLocations
to inform you of Global Entry interview openings.
There is another project on GitHub that used to accomplish the same thing, but the new DHS web site broke it. I found it only after I got this thing working, so I thought I'd post this anyway for whomever may benefit from it.
pip install -r requirements.txt
config.py.template
to a new file config.py
config.py
: